Free cookie consent management tool by TermsFeed Policy Generator

Ignore:
Timestamp:
06/12/13 13:32:34 (11 years ago)
Author:
mkommend
Message:

#1734: Added StorableConstructor to all storable DataImporter classes.

Location:
branches/HeuristicLab.DataImporter/HeuristicLab.DataImporter.Data
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• branches/HeuristicLab.DataImporter/HeuristicLab.DataImporter.Data

    • Property svn:ignore
      •  

        old new  
        11bin
        22obj
         3*.user
  • branches/HeuristicLab.DataImporter/HeuristicLab.DataImporter.Data/Model/ColumnBase.cs

    r8387 r9614  
    2828  [StorableClass]
    2929  public abstract class ColumnBase {
    30     private ColumnBase() {
    31     }
     30    [StorableConstructor]
     31    protected ColumnBase(bool deserializing) : base() { }
    3232
    3333    protected ColumnBase(string name)
    34       : this() {
     34      : base() {
    3535      this.sortOrder = SortOrder.None;
    3636      this.name = name;
    3737    }
    3838
    39     private Type dataType;
    40     public Type DataType {
    41       get { return dataType; }
    42       protected set { this.dataType = value; }
    43     }
     39    public abstract Type DataType { get; }
    4440
    4541    [Storable]
Note: See TracChangeset for help on using the changeset viewer.